planetary mixers 3dito electrolux 10 litre planetary mixer to satisfy all requirements of a professionalkitchen

·

Knead all types of doughs and pastry, mix meats and sauces and emulsify creams

·

Electronic speed variation allows an accurate setting of all parameters

·

Powerful motor with frequency variator permits a precise adjustment of the planetary mechanism speed between 26 and 180 rpm

·

Splash proof planetary system ensures water does not enter themechanism

·

18/8 stainless steel bowl , 10 litre capacity

·

Supplied with 3 tools : stainless steel whisk, robust paddle and spiralhook

·

Tools rotate at speeds from 55 to 378 rpm

XBE10

750 W

·

Stainless steel column protects themotor and speed variator protection against humidity or jets ofwater

·

Height adjustable feet ensure stability

·

User friendly touch button control panel for improved ergonomics and precise operation

·

Equipped with 0-59 minute timer for an even more

·

The simple movement of the safetyscreen raises and lowers the bowl and at the same time stops the motor

·

The transparent safety screen can be easily removed for an accuratecleaning

·

Available with accessory hub onrequest

·

Kneading capacity (hook): 3,5 kg of flour (50% moisture content)

·

Whisking capacity: 16 eggs

·

Mixing capacity (paddle): 5 kg of potatoes or meat

·

The model with mechanical speedvariation (XBM10) is equipped with a 2speed motor. Choose up to 8 different levels for each speed Stainless steel columnTouch button control panel Transparent safety screenKit (bowl, hook, paddle, whisk)
